Transaction 90c707b39f6175b49c99faa3ed331601da3461241339bb313ec451624b790335
1 Input
2 Outputs
- 90c707b39f6175b49c99faa3ed331601da3461241339bb313ec451624b790335:0
- 90c707b39f6175b49c99faa3ed331601da3461241339bb313ec451624b790335:1
value 210770000
address 1JJuQJsL42MinbfWWze2wzqKm8ys4VTZAg
value 9320710000
address 17BymcHaGRbXGnEzR2m9woUYNf9FBPPJ2P